harry styles is one of the night s big winners, with four awards, including the much coveted album of the year. hello and welcome to bbc news. the world health organisation says that almost 26 million people have been affected by the earthquakes that struck turkey and syria. the number confirmed dead has passed 28,000. on a visit to southern turkey, the un aid chief, martin griffiths, said there was an urgent need for medical assistance, as well as food and shelter for survivors. now rescue efforts are being hampered by a worsening security situation in southern turkey. there have been reports of looting and clashes between unnamed groups. more than a hundred people have been detained across the 10 provinces affected by the quakes, with the justice ministry ordering officials to set up so called earthquake crimes investigations units. 0ur correspondent, nick beake, is in gazientep. minor miracles are still happening, even after all this time. a five year old girl rescue ....

But medical facilities here are obviously overwhelmed, as you know, so there s a huge need for urgent medical care, mobile clinics, field hospitals i think the united kingdom is sending in a field hospital, for example. and then, the period of humanitarian aid, the next three months, for which we are appealing, which will cover shelter, livelihoods, food, nutrition and health care. and so, to give people a sense those people who ve had to leave their homes that there is a stable future awaiting them, even in this awful time. 0ur chief international correspondent lyse doucet speaking to the un humanitarian chief, martin griffiths. and as you might expect, there is more on this story on bbc news online and on the bbc news app, where you ll find a special index with the latest news articles, as well as video reports from our correspondent in the region. there s also some of the remarkable stories of survival. ....
